aboutsummaryrefslogtreecommitdiffstats
path: root/sysutils
diff options
context:
space:
mode:
authortcberner <tcberner@FreeBSD.org>2018-05-26 05:44:12 +0800
committertcberner <tcberner@FreeBSD.org>2018-05-26 05:44:12 +0800
commit266909a81ee9b32a24cbc0c796151df9dbecd31b (patch)
tree86e71c0056b8414191c8b421101694a177fec03e /sysutils
parentaf77a773663952af545150a39ecb4d87a6d4b365 (diff)
downloadfreebsd-ports-graphics-266909a81ee9b32a24cbc0c796151df9dbecd31b.tar.gz
freebsd-ports-graphics-266909a81ee9b32a24cbc0c796151df9dbecd31b.tar.zst
freebsd-ports-graphics-266909a81ee9b32a24cbc0c796151df9dbecd31b.zip
Update lang/ghc 8.4.2 and the hs-* ports the newer versions
* Update lang/ghc to 8.4.2 * Update the boostrap compiler to 8.4.1 * Update the many hs-* ports * Bump the rest Thanks a lot to arrowd for doing all the heavy lifting :) PR: 227968 Exp-run by: antoine Submitted by: arrowd Differential Revision: https://reviews.freebsd.org/D15005
Diffstat (limited to 'sysutils')
-rw-r--r--sysutils/hs-angel/Makefile4
-rw-r--r--sysutils/hs-cpu/Makefile2
-rw-r--r--sysutils/hs-disk-free-space/Makefile2
-rw-r--r--sysutils/hs-ekg-core/Makefile5
-rw-r--r--sysutils/hs-ekg-core/distinfo6
-rw-r--r--sysutils/hs-ekg-core/files/patch-ekg-core.cabal11
-rw-r--r--sysutils/hs-ekg-json/Makefile5
-rw-r--r--sysutils/hs-ekg-json/distinfo6
-rw-r--r--sysutils/hs-ekg-json/files/patch-ekg-json.cabal13
-rw-r--r--sysutils/hs-ekg/Makefile5
-rw-r--r--sysutils/hs-ekg/distinfo6
-rw-r--r--sysutils/hs-ekg/files/patch-ekg.cabal11
-rw-r--r--sysutils/hs-mountpoints/Makefile2
13 files changed, 55 insertions, 23 deletions
diff --git a/sysutils/hs-angel/Makefile b/sysutils/hs-angel/Makefile
index c453d6d0048..c8224676db5 100644
--- a/sysutils/hs-angel/Makefile
+++ b/sysutils/hs-angel/Makefile
@@ -2,7 +2,7 @@
PORTNAME= angel
PORTVERSION= 0.6.2
-PORTREVISION= 2
+PORTREVISION= 4
CATEGORIES= sysutils haskell
MAINTAINER= haskell@FreeBSD.org
@@ -11,7 +11,7 @@ COMMENT= Process management and supervision daemon
LICENSE= BSD3CLAUSE
USE_CABAL= configurator>=0.1 mtl old-locale optparse-applicative \
- stm>=2.0 text>=0.11 unordered-containers>=0.1.4
+ unordered-containers>=0.1.4
EXECUTABLE= angel
diff --git a/sysutils/hs-cpu/Makefile b/sysutils/hs-cpu/Makefile
index 16688066716..d8285271a16 100644
--- a/sysutils/hs-cpu/Makefile
+++ b/sysutils/hs-cpu/Makefile
@@ -2,7 +2,7 @@
PORTNAME= cpu
PORTVERSION= 0.1.2
-PORTREVISION= 4
+PORTREVISION= 5
CATEGORIES= sysutils haskell
MAINTAINER= haskell@FreeBSD.org
diff --git a/sysutils/hs-disk-free-space/Makefile b/sysutils/hs-disk-free-space/Makefile
index 06841e31f1b..4433e37b857 100644
--- a/sysutils/hs-disk-free-space/Makefile
+++ b/sysutils/hs-disk-free-space/Makefile
@@ -2,7 +2,7 @@
PORTNAME= disk-free-space
PORTVERSION= 0.1.0.1
-PORTREVISION= 1
+PORTREVISION= 2
CATEGORIES= sysutils haskell
MAINTAINER= haskell@FreeBSD.org
diff --git a/sysutils/hs-ekg-core/Makefile b/sysutils/hs-ekg-core/Makefile
index cb653f9476d..a419ab62ce8 100644
--- a/sysutils/hs-ekg-core/Makefile
+++ b/sysutils/hs-ekg-core/Makefile
@@ -1,8 +1,7 @@
# $FreeBSD$
PORTNAME= ekg-core
-PORTVERSION= 0.1.1.1
-PORTREVISION= 1
+PORTVERSION= 0.1.1.4
CATEGORIES= sysutils haskell
MAINTAINER= haskell@FreeBSD.org
@@ -10,7 +9,7 @@ COMMENT= Tracking of system metrics
LICENSE= BSD3CLAUSE
-USE_CABAL= text unordered-containers
+USE_CABAL= unordered-containers
.include "${.CURDIR}/../../lang/ghc/bsd.cabal.mk"
.include <bsd.port.mk>
diff --git a/sysutils/hs-ekg-core/distinfo b/sysutils/hs-ekg-core/distinfo
index b4761f240d9..c113e735dfa 100644
--- a/sysutils/hs-ekg-core/distinfo
+++ b/sysutils/hs-ekg-core/distinfo
@@ -1,3 +1,3 @@
-TIMESTAMP = 1499538190
-SHA256 (cabal/ekg-core-0.1.1.1.tar.gz) = 54de3df4b1b027aa2f3760b64f6a8c8134f3275b6d95bf1cf1fc0e74282939d6
-SIZE (cabal/ekg-core-0.1.1.1.tar.gz) = 12426
+TIMESTAMP = 1523637800
+SHA256 (cabal/ekg-core-0.1.1.4.tar.gz) = 66d89acca05c1c91dc57a9c4b3f62d25ccd0c04bb2bfd46d5947f9b8cd8ee937
+SIZE (cabal/ekg-core-0.1.1.4.tar.gz) = 13252
diff --git a/sysutils/hs-ekg-core/files/patch-ekg-core.cabal b/sysutils/hs-ekg-core/files/patch-ekg-core.cabal
new file mode 100644
index 00000000000..b5952457386
--- /dev/null
+++ b/sysutils/hs-ekg-core/files/patch-ekg-core.cabal
@@ -0,0 +1,11 @@
+--- ekg-core.cabal.orig 2018-04-13 16:45:53 UTC
++++ ekg-core.cabal
+@@ -33,7 +33,7 @@ library
+
+ build-depends:
+ ghc-prim < 0.6,
+- base >= 4.5 && < 4.11,
++ base >= 4.5 && < 4.12,
+ containers >= 0.5 && < 0.6,
+ text < 1.3,
+ unordered-containers < 0.3
diff --git a/sysutils/hs-ekg-json/Makefile b/sysutils/hs-ekg-json/Makefile
index 1ac3e196b7e..bb8ba279724 100644
--- a/sysutils/hs-ekg-json/Makefile
+++ b/sysutils/hs-ekg-json/Makefile
@@ -1,8 +1,7 @@
# $FreeBSD$
PORTNAME= ekg-json
-PORTVERSION= 0.1.0.5
-PORTREVISION= 1
+PORTVERSION= 0.1.0.6
CATEGORIES= sysutils haskell
MAINTAINER= haskell@FreeBSD.org
@@ -10,7 +9,7 @@ COMMENT= JSON encoding of ekg metrics
LICENSE= BSD3CLAUSE
-USE_CABAL= aeson ekg-core>=0.1 text unordered-containers
+USE_CABAL= aeson ekg-core>=0.1 unordered-containers
.include "${.CURDIR}/../../lang/ghc/bsd.cabal.mk"
.include <bsd.port.mk>
diff --git a/sysutils/hs-ekg-json/distinfo b/sysutils/hs-ekg-json/distinfo
index b5c864a8756..9f281afa82d 100644
--- a/sysutils/hs-ekg-json/distinfo
+++ b/sysutils/hs-ekg-json/distinfo
@@ -1,3 +1,3 @@
-TIMESTAMP = 1499546477
-SHA256 (cabal/ekg-json-0.1.0.5.tar.gz) = 0cd5ecae57a156a5c779acff70d0fa3b02c52cb05283c0effb62a2902ebe8556
-SIZE (cabal/ekg-json-0.1.0.5.tar.gz) = 3092
+TIMESTAMP = 1524430137
+SHA256 (cabal/ekg-json-0.1.0.6.tar.gz) = 1e6a80aa0a28bbf41c9c6364cbb5731160d14fa54145f27a82d0b3467a04dd47
+SIZE (cabal/ekg-json-0.1.0.6.tar.gz) = 3094
diff --git a/sysutils/hs-ekg-json/files/patch-ekg-json.cabal b/sysutils/hs-ekg-json/files/patch-ekg-json.cabal
new file mode 100644
index 00000000000..d3ae028c199
--- /dev/null
+++ b/sysutils/hs-ekg-json/files/patch-ekg-json.cabal
@@ -0,0 +1,13 @@
+--- ekg-json.cabal.orig 2018-04-22 20:52:14 UTC
++++ ekg-json.cabal
+@@ -20,8 +20,8 @@ library
+ exposed-modules:
+ System.Metrics.Json
+ build-depends:
+- aeson >=0.4 && < 1.3,
+- base >= 4.5 && < 4.11,
++ aeson >=0.4 && < 1.4,
++ base >= 4.5 && < 4.12,
+ ekg-core >= 0.1 && < 0.2,
+ text < 1.3,
+ unordered-containers < 0.3
diff --git a/sysutils/hs-ekg/Makefile b/sysutils/hs-ekg/Makefile
index e2b6b5fed0f..e55e130edfd 100644
--- a/sysutils/hs-ekg/Makefile
+++ b/sysutils/hs-ekg/Makefile
@@ -1,8 +1,7 @@
# $FreeBSD$
PORTNAME= ekg
-PORTVERSION= 0.4.0.13
-PORTREVISION= 1
+PORTVERSION= 0.4.0.15
CATEGORIES= sysutils haskell
MAINTAINER= haskell@FreeBSD.org
@@ -11,7 +10,7 @@ COMMENT= Remote monitoring of processes
LICENSE= BSD3CLAUSE
USE_CABAL= aeson ekg-core>=0.1 ekg-json>=0.1 network snap-core \
- snap-server text unordered-containers
+ snap-server unordered-containers
.include "${.CURDIR}/../../lang/ghc/bsd.cabal.mk"
.include <bsd.port.mk>
diff --git a/sysutils/hs-ekg/distinfo b/sysutils/hs-ekg/distinfo
index a35492f70bb..65a05039092 100644
--- a/sysutils/hs-ekg/distinfo
+++ b/sysutils/hs-ekg/distinfo
@@ -1,3 +1,3 @@
-TIMESTAMP = 1499624252
-SHA256 (cabal/ekg-0.4.0.13.tar.gz) = 44b1d5987e8d8061aaf05fd96f9072399ba16b07999caf5186e856c7e47bb48f
-SIZE (cabal/ekg-0.4.0.13.tar.gz) = 171231
+TIMESTAMP = 1525008611
+SHA256 (cabal/ekg-0.4.0.15.tar.gz) = 482ae3be495cfe4f03332ad1c79ce8b5ad4f9c8eec824980c664808ae32c6dcc
+SIZE (cabal/ekg-0.4.0.15.tar.gz) = 171305
diff --git a/sysutils/hs-ekg/files/patch-ekg.cabal b/sysutils/hs-ekg/files/patch-ekg.cabal
new file mode 100644
index 00000000000..ae5cd41e4ce
--- /dev/null
+++ b/sysutils/hs-ekg/files/patch-ekg.cabal
@@ -0,0 +1,11 @@
+--- ekg.cabal.orig 2018-04-29 13:38:25 UTC
++++ ekg.cabal
+@@ -39,7 +39,7 @@ library
+ System.Remote.Snap
+
+ build-depends:
+- aeson >= 0.4 && < 1.3,
++ aeson >= 0.4 && < 1.4,
+ base >= 4.5 && < 4.12,
+ bytestring < 1.0,
+ ekg-core >= 0.1 && < 0.2,
diff --git a/sysutils/hs-mountpoints/Makefile b/sysutils/hs-mountpoints/Makefile
index 8fa735387a8..6796ef37302 100644
--- a/sysutils/hs-mountpoints/Makefile
+++ b/sysutils/hs-mountpoints/Makefile
@@ -2,7 +2,7 @@
PORTNAME= mountpoints
PORTVERSION= 1.0.2
-PORTREVISION= 1
+PORTREVISION= 2
CATEGORIES= sysutils haskell
MAINTAINER= haskell@FreeBSD.org